Latest Patents

Hervé Bastian holds a patent for a method titled "In vitro production of a cell population using feeder cells." This groundbreaking invention outlines a process for the in vitro production of a cell population P’ from an initial cell population P, requiring the presence of specific factors expressed by feeder cells. The method involves several steps, including the proliferation of feeder cells at a designated temperature, contact with the cell population P, and careful cultivation to ensure optimal growth conditions for the desired cell population. This innovative technique is particularly beneficial for expanding T lymphocyte populations, offering valuable implications for therapeutic applications.
